The Pine Gulch Fire was started by a lightning strike on July 31, 2020, approximately 18 miles north of Grand Junction, Colorado. Road systems were used as control lines where crews initiated firing operations to slow the fire spread. During the night of August 18, the fire grew quickly due to thunderstorm winds up to 40 mph for a three to four hour period.
